Open Kovaak’s settings, navigate to the Main tab, and set your . Input your exact in-game sensitivity value. This ensures your centimeters-per-360 ( ) movement is identical. 2. Field of View (FOV)
Dynamic clicking features moving targets that must be destroyed with single clicks. This directly replicates an enemy Jet dashing across your screen, a Neon sliding around a corner, or a player wide-swinging from behind a box. Micro-Adjustments (The Precision Finisher)
